Role Overview
As a Senior Web Developer , you will play a key role in building the next generation of the State Street research , operation, and platform s . You will contribute hands-on to the design and development of intelligent, leveraging modern frontend frameworks, cloud-native architectures, and emerging generative UI pattern s .
This role goes beyond traditional frontend development. You will work at the intersection of web engineering, UX, partnering closely with designers, backend engineers, and data teams to deliver highly interactive, adaptive, and insight-driven user experiences. The ideal candidate is a strong hands-on developer with a solid modern web foundation, curiosity for AI-enabled UX, and a passion for building innovative user interfaces.
Key Responsibilities
- Design and develop modern, AI-driven web applications, including adaptive and emerging generative UI patterns, primarily using Angular and TypeScript .
- Build intuitive, responsive, and high-performance user interfaces that integrate with backend and AI services.
- Collaborate closely with UX designers, product managers, and backend/data engineers to translate business and AI capabilities into practical, user-friendly solutions.
- Contribute to frontend architecture decisions, code quality standards, and best practices for maintainability, scalability, and performance.
- Participate in proofs of concept and experiments exploring new technologies in web (e.g., advanced data visualization , complex automation workflows ).
- Write clean, maintainable, and well-tested code; participate actively in code reviews and design discussions.
- Troubleshoot and resolve complex frontend issues, ensuring high standards of reliability, security, and accessibility.
- Stay current with trends in modern web development and user experiences, and apply learnings to day-to-day development work.
- Provide guidance and support to junior developers as needed, contributing to a collaborative and learning-focused team environment.
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field (or equivalent practical experience).
- 3–5 years of experience in modern web/frontend development.
- Strong proficiency in Angular, TypeScript, HTML, and CSS , with exposure to other frameworks such as React being a plus.
- Solid understanding of building modular, maintainable frontend components and working within enterprise-scale applications.
- Experience working with API-driven architectures and integrating frontend applications with backend services.
- Good understanding of frontend performance optimization, responsiveness, and cross-browser compatibility.
- Familiarity with secure coding practices and enterprise application standards.
- Experience with data-rich or visualization-heavy applications (charts, dashboards, analytics) is a plus.
- Strong problem-solving skills and attention to detail.
- Effective communication skills and the ability to work collaboratively in a cross-functional team environment.
- Exposure or interest in AI-integrated web patterns , such as:
- Consuming AI/LLM APIs
- Chat or conversational interfaces
- AI-assisted UI/UX or data visualization
- Dynamic or adaptive UI components
- Demonstrated curiosity and willingness to learn new technologies, especially in the AI and modern web space.
